If you're in the cryptocurrency community, chances are you've exchanged a message or two or swapped mining stories with HashRaptor. He started making YouTube videos in January of 2019 and has been creating amazing content and helping out his community of supporters on YouTube and Discord with regular videos of everything from building a shed for crypto mining to creative endurance and torture tests of portable Solid State drives. Then in the first couple days of October his Father, a surviving Delta Force Special Forces operator, still cancer free, and one of the toughest people he's ever known- had a massive stroke while caring for his Mother who was in the hospital having just had back surgery. After several days with both parents in the hospital, he ended up bringing his Father home to be with his family in his final days. His Father, who HashRaptor would say was the biggest fan of his YouTube channel even though he was told he had no idea what any of it meant, watched every one of the videos that was uploaded. Then just days later, his Mother who was still in the hospital recovering from back surgery, had a heart attack due to all the stress and then underwent open heart surgery. That same day when his Mother was still in critical condition after surgery, his Father passed away at home with he and his family by his side. A few days later in the evening, his Mother was moved out of the ICU, fighting and doing better each day. He then had to tell her one of the hardest things he has ever done, that her Husband was gone. She was only sad about how much she was going to miss him but otherwise was very positive about the future. October 22nd was very somber day, as they buried his Father in a National Cemetery. His Father’s special forces team was there to send him off, as were his friends and family. HashRaptor’s Mother was able to watch via live stream from her hospital room. She is doing a little better each day, and will be moved out of the hospital into a rehab facility on October 24th. She still can't walk and her energy is very low, but every day there is something a little better to be thankful for. HashRaptor has been in hospitals and taking care of his parents house for the past few weeks. With his Father’s passing this puts his Mother in a difficult financial situation because the military retirement payments will cease and most of the monthly income for his Mother will go away. This puts his Mother up against the possibility of losing the house.
